New Smyrna Beach located on the central east coast of Florida, just an hour drive east from Orlando, is more than just a sleepy beach town. Although you can definitely get plenty of rest if you just want to chill and relax. But NSB has lots to see and do. It’s not only been rated one of “Florida’s Top 10 Beach Towns” by USA Today, it’s also one of the “Top Surf Towns in the world”, and one of “The 100 Best Small Art Towns in America” thanks in part to being home of The Atlantic Center for the Arts(ACA). (In fact, that is where I met MacKenzie for the first time as she was whipping up grilled cheeses for a charity event.)
Foodies would be happy to know there are no chain restaurants on New Smyrna’s beachside. Everything is locally owned with only mom-and-pop style restaurants.

Churro French Toast Grilled Cheese with Strawberry and Dulce De Leche Recipe

- 1 egg
- 1/4 cup milk
- 1/8 tsp cinnamon
- 1/4 tsp vanilla
- 3 tbsp butter divided
- 4 slices thick cut white bread
- 2 tbsp white sugar
- 1/8 tsp cinnamon
- 4 tbsp cream cheese
- ¼ cup fresh strawberries
- 2 tbsp dulce de leche
-
In a shallow bowl, whisk together egg, milk, cinnamon and vanilla and set aside.
-
Melt 1/2 tbsp of butter in a large nonstick fry pan over medium heat.
-
Dip 1 piece of bread in egg mixture being sure to coat both sides and place it in the fry pan. Repeat with second slice.
-
Cook both slices until golden brown then flip and add another 1/2 tbsp of butter.
-
Repeat this process for the remaining two slices of bread.
-
While the second batch is cooking, mix together white sugar and cinnamon and set aside.
-
Once all the french toast is cooked, toss each piece in the cinnamon and sugar.
-
Smear half the cream cheese onto each slice of French Toast.
-
Top with sliced strawberries and sandwich both halves together.
-
Heat on a cast iron skillet or panini press over medium low heat for 5 minutes, until cheese softens.
-
Remove from heat and carefully pull top off the sandwich.
-
Drizzle interior with dulce de leche and close the sandwich back up.
-
Carefully toss the sandwich in the cinnamon sugar mixture to cover it.
-
Serve immediately.
These are my notes and observations after following the recipes:
- I used whipped cream cheese and reduced the amount of time I heated the sandwich on a cast iron skillet since the cream cheese is already softened.
- You can use strawberry preserves if you don’t have fresh strawberries. You can also use other berries.
- Keep your pan on lower heat than you normally would to cook slower and get a golden brown bread. The butter burns easily at higher temps.
- If you don’t have dulce de leche, you can use caramel or toffee ice cream topping.
- I added more cinnamon to my French Toast batter because I like it more cinnamony. You do you!
- Don’t be afraid to be generous with the cinnamon sugar coating on the French Toast. It is freakin’ delicious!
